The biodegradation of industrial pollutants using fungi is a fascinating and promising area of research. In this chapter, the potential of various fungal strains to degrade and detoxify industrial pollutants is explored, focusing on their ability to break down complex compounds commonly found in industrial waste. By harnessing the unique enzymatic capabilities of fungi, this chapter aims to identify eco-friendly and sustainable solutions for mitigating the environmental impact of industrial activities. The types of fungi capable of efficiently degrading industrial pollutants are discussed, along with the mechanism involved in the degradation process, and the performance of these fungi is assessed under different environmental conditions. Additionally, factors such as pH, temperature, moisture content, and nature of pollutants are covered in this chapter. The advantages, challenges, and prospects of using fungi to degrade industrial pollutants are also included. The outcomes of this chapter have the potential to offer practical and scalable solutions for industrial waste management. Understanding and harnessing the biodegradative capabilities of fungi can contribute to developing innovative and environmentally friendly strategies to address the challenges posed by industrial pollutants.
